Blade precision is essential because it determines how true your cuts will be. A high-quality blade with sharp teeth and proper alignment ensures minimal wandering and cleaner cuts. When the blade is precise, even a slightly imperfect fence can yield excellent results. Conversely, a poorly manufactured or dull blade will produce inaccuracies, regardless of how perfectly the fence is aligned. So, investing in a blade known for its precision can markedly improve your work, especially if you’re doing fine woodworking or detailed joinery. Motor power also plays a critical role. A more powerful motor provides consistent torque, reducing the risk of the blade bogging down under load. When your saw has sufficient power, it maintains blade speed, resulting in cleaner cuts with fewer deviations. A weak motor may cause the blade to slow unexpectedly, leading to inaccurate cuts and rough edges. Additionally, a powerful motor can handle thicker or denser hardwoods without sacrificing accuracy, which is essential for versatile projects. How Often Should I Calibrate My Table Saw?

You should calibrate your table saw whenever you notice inaccuracies or after heavy use, ideally every few months. Focus on checking blade alignment regularly to ensure precise cuts. Keep dust collection in mind, as buildup can affect performance and calibration. Maintaining proper blade alignment and clear dust pathways helps you achieve consistent accuracy, reducing the need for frequent recalibrations and keeping your cuts precise and safe.
